How Long a Wall Can Edgebanding Cover? Exploring the Limits of Melamine and PVC Edgebanding331
As a leading manufacturer of edgebanding in China, we frequently get asked about the practical limitations of our products. One question that consistently arises concerns the maximum length of a wall that our edgebanding can effectively cover. While there isn't a single, definitive answer – "infinitely long" is technically correct, practically speaking, there are several factors that determine the feasible length of a wall application using our melamine and PVC edgebanding.
The simple answer is: the length of the wall is limited not by the edgebanding itself, but by the practical considerations of installation, transportation, and the structural integrity of the wall being edged. Our edgebanding is produced in standard roll lengths, typically ranging from 30 meters to 50 meters depending on the specific product and customer order. This means that, theoretically, you could cover a wall significantly longer than a single roll by seamlessly joining multiple rolls together. However, the longer the wall, the more complex and potentially problematic the installation becomes.
Let's break down the factors that influence the practical limit:
1. Installation Challenges:
The installation process of edgebanding requires precision and skill. Seamless joining of multiple rolls of edgebanding necessitates careful matching of patterns and textures to avoid visible discrepancies. Longer walls present a greater challenge in maintaining consistent application and minimizing the visibility of joins. Imperfect joins can lead to unsightly gaps or overlaps, compromising the aesthetic appeal of the finished product. While skilled installers can overcome this challenge, the probability of minor imperfections increases with the overall length of the wall. The longer the wall, the more time, effort, and potentially higher labor costs are involved.
Furthermore, the physical act of handling and applying edgebanding over extended lengths requires more effort and potentially specialized tools. Maintaining consistent tension and pressure along the entire length becomes progressively harder, potentially leading to irregularities in the final finish.
2. Transportation and Handling:
Transporting and handling long rolls of edgebanding can be demanding. While we package our rolls carefully to protect them from damage during transit, longer rolls are inherently more susceptible to bending, kinking, or even tearing, especially during transportation and storage. This is particularly important to consider for large-scale projects, where the volume of edgebanding required might necessitate multiple shipments. Any damage to the rolls before installation adds extra complexity and cost.
3. Substrate Considerations:
The wall itself plays a crucial role. The surface needs to be properly prepared and primed for optimal adhesion of the edgebanding. A longer wall increases the likelihood of encountering variations in the surface quality along its length, demanding extra attention to preparation. Inconsistent substrate conditions can lead to uneven application and adhesion problems, particularly noticeable over longer distances.
The structural integrity of the wall is also critical. A wall that is not properly supported or constructed may not be suitable for edgebanding, irrespective of the edgebanding’s length. Any movement or instability in the substrate can cause the edgebanding to lift, peel, or become damaged over time, particularly problematic with longer stretches.
4. Edgebanding Type:
The type of edgebanding also impacts the feasible length. Melamine edgebanding, known for its durability and affordability, is generally easier to install than PVC edgebanding. However, even with melamine, extremely long applications might show subtle inconsistencies due to variations in the material itself. PVC edgebanding, while offering superior resistance to moisture and wear, can be more challenging to install flawlessly over extensive lengths due to its potential for expansion and contraction with temperature changes.
5. Project Planning & Logistics:
Large-scale projects requiring edgebanding for extremely long walls demand meticulous planning. This includes accurate measurements, precise ordering of materials, coordinated delivery schedules, and the deployment of a sufficient number of experienced installers to complete the job efficiently and to a high standard. Failing to consider these logistics can lead to delays, cost overruns, and suboptimal results.
